Ironically it's also the very thing... WebMay 12, 2024 · If you’re successful, you will reduce your own taxes, but not at the expense of revenue needed by your municipality. Rather, the municipality determines how much revenue it needs and sets a tax rate that is applied to all property owners. Your grievance will simply reduce your share of that burden.

WebMay 12, 2024 · First, you need the Complaint on Real Property Assessment for (Form RP-524), which is a standard New York State form used to file grievances across the state. The form mostly requires you to fill out information on you, your property, and the nature of your grievance. Second, you need a letter in support. A denial of your application for tax deferral. WebApr 24, 2009 · You can definitely grieve your taxes yourself. It is a 2 part process. The first filing is due by May 19,2009 with your local board. You will file the complaint form along with a copy of your appraisal and contract of sale. The target valuation date is 7/1/08. You need to prove what your house is worth as of that date.
